TypeScript will look for the relative files ./foo.ios.ts, ./foo.native.ts, and finally ./foo.ts. Note the empty string "" in moduleSuffixes which is necessary for TypeScript to also look-up ./foo.ts. This feature can be useful for React Native projects where each target platform can use a separate tsconfig.json with differing moduleSuffixes.

To begin your TypeScript project, you will need to create a directory for your project: mkdir typescript-project. Now change into your project directory: cd typescript-project. With your project directory set up, you can install TypeScript: npm i typescript --save-dev.

JavaScript has three very commonly used primitives: string, number, and boolean . Each has a corresponding type in TypeScript. As you might expect, these are the same names you’d see if you used the JavaScript typeof operator on a value of those types: string represents string values like "Hello ... Use ts-node. If you need to run or debug single TypeScript files with Node.js, you can use ts-node instead of compiling your code as described in Compiling TypeScript into JavaScript. Install ts-node. In the embedded Terminal (Alt+F12) , type: npm install --save-dev ts-node. To add creation of .d.ts files in your project, you will need to do up-to four steps: Add TypeScript to your dev dependencies. Add a tsconfig.json to configure TypeScript. Run the TypeScript compiler to generate the corresponding d.ts files for JS files. (optional) Edit your package.json to reference the types.

Object Types. In JavaScript, the fundamental way that we group and pass around data is through objects. In TypeScript, we represent those through object types. As we’ve seen, they can be anonymous: function greet ( person: { name: string; age: number }) {. return "Hello " + person. name; } Congratulations. Using Vue with TypeScript. A type system like TypeScript can detect many common errors via static analysis at build time. This reduces the chance of runtime errors in production, and also allows us to more confidently refactor code in large-scale applications. TypeScript also improves developer ergonomics via type-based auto-completion in IDEs. Installing the Compiler. TypeScript has an official compiler which can be installed through npm. Learn more about npm, and how to get started here: What is npm? Within your npm project, run the following command to install the compiler: npm install typescript --save-dev.
